Message Text |
SQL Server Assertion: File: <%s>, line = %d %s. This error may be timing-related. If the error persists after rerunning the statement, use DBCC CHECKDB to check the database for structural integrity, or restart the server to ensure in-memory data structures are not corrupted. |
Explanation
This error can be caused by transient, timing-related errors, or by in-memory or on-disk data corruption.
User Action
Rerun the statement that caused the exception to fire. If the error was caused by a timing-related event, the error may not recur. If the problem persists, run DBCC CHECKDB to check for on-disk corruption. Restart the server to ensure that the in-memory data structures are not corrupted.
